一种改进的中轴骨架三维模型检索算法

3D model retrieval based on enhanced medial axis skeleton
下载PDF
导出
摘要 针对三维模型检索算法性能较低的问题,提出了一种改进的中轴骨架三维模型检索算法。 To improve the efficiency of 3D model retrieval, an algorithm for 3D model retrieval based on enhanced medial axis skeleton was proposed in this paper.
作者 张学锋
出处 《电子技术应用》 北大核心 2007年第8期62-65,共4页 Application of Electronic Technique
关键词 三维模型检索 特征变换 中轴骨架 骨架二叉树 3D model retrieval feature transform medial axis skeletons skeletal binary tree
